The Methodist Family Child Care Center and Kindergarten offers full day, full year child care for children ages 6 weeks through 5 years.
Preschool and Pre-Kindergarten are provided to children ages 3 years-5 years.
Kindergarten is offered to children who are 5 years old by September 1st.
